On average across the year,
yes, California, United States is hotter than
Spokane Valley, Washington
.
California, United States has an average temperature of 18°C/64°F and Spokane Valley, Washington has an average temperature of 8°C/46°F.
California, United States's hottest month is July, with an average maximum temperature of 30°C/86°F, which is approximately the same temperature as Spokane Valley, Washington's hottest month (also July, with an average maximum temperature of 30°C/86°F).
On average across the year, no, California, United States is not colder than Spokane Valley, Washington . California, United States has an average minimum temperature of 12°C/54°F and Spokane Valley, Washington has an average minimum temperature of 1°C/34°F.
On average across the year,
no, California, United States has less rain than
Spokane Valley, Washington. California, United States has an average annual rainfall of 261mm and Spokane Valley, Washington has an average annual rainfall of 586mm.
California, United States's wettest month is December, with an average monthly rainfall of 56mm, which is drier than Spokane Valley, Washington's wettest month (January, with an average monthly rainfall of 77mm).
